Graduated Fool is the third studio album from Dutch singer Anouk, released on 22 November 2002.[1] The album yielded three singles: "Everything" peaked at number 12 in the Dutch top 40, second single "I Live For You" failed to chart and third single "Hail" peaked at number 31, due to a lack of promotion because Anouk was pregnant with her son Elijah. The album itself peaked at number 3 in the Dutch album chart. With 25.000 copies sold, it was her least successful album to date.[2]

Track list

  1. "Too Long" – 3:55
  2. "Everything" – 4:24
  3. "Hail" – 3:53
  4. "Who Cares" – 4:37
  5. "Graduated Fool" – 3:52
  6. "Stop Thinking" – 4:18
  7. "No Time To Waste" – 3:57
  8. "Searching" – 3:54
  9. "Margarita Chum" – 4:19
  10. "I Live For You" – 3:40
  11. "Bigger Side" – 4:41

Personnel

  • Bass – Michel van Schie
  • Drums – Hans Eijkenaar
  • Electric Guitar – Leendert Haaksma, Lex Bolderdijk (tracks: 2, 4), René van Barneveld
  • Engineer – Holger Schwedt, John Sonneveld
  • Mastered By – Greg Calbi
  • Mixed By – Michael H. Brauer
  • Mixed By [Assistant] – Nathaniel Chan, Ricardo Chavarria
  • Photography By – Allard Honigh, Frans Jansen (3)
  • Producer – Anouk
  • Written-By – A. Teeuwe (tracks: 1 to 10), B. van Veen (tracks: 1 to 10)
